Believe in Yourself

How to unlock motivation and achieve inspiration

For years I was the typical writer. I would sit around waiting for that one piece of brilliant inspiration to propel me to the next Pulitzer Prize winning piece. I don't quite know if it was supposed to be magical or mystical in nature. I just knew it was supposed to happen. Of course it never did.

Going where this man has gone before

The question became why hasn't this come to me? Just as with that inspiration I was waiting for, the answer wasn't about to materialize on it's own either. So, I sat around one day brainstorming on paper the why's and why nots. Why could I find the inspiration to create complete entertainment shows and characters to perform, but not find the inspiration to write? Why could I conjure up methods to create charitable events to raise money but not create pieces of literature to raise money for me? How was it I was able to direct thousands of others to the inspiration to that would help drive them forward day after day but not myself? The answer which changed my life was so simplistic it registered a hundred and two on the Homer Simpson “Duh” meter. The answer, it has always been right there in front of me. For others and other things I would just hand it over. For myself, I would just look past it. I was reaching beyond what was right in front of me. I was doing what I had found the people I helped stop doing. By going to where I would show others to go. I found my own inspiration. Better yet, it was the same place I went to for all things outside of my writing.

The key is the magic of you

The irony is I drew on the knowledge of how to create inspiration for all things not me. I was very much being the shoemaker who's kids had no shoes. Even better the housewife creates that wondrous meal but winds up eating the leftovers or burnt portions. We do this because we are taught doing for other is more noble. Many times when you live this way you fall into the trap of putting yourself outside of your own considerations. In a sense you become either blind or seemingly put up a “can't go there for me” wall. What we don't realize is those who experience how we guided them to inspiration think in of it terms of this couldn't have happened without the magic of you.

A mathematical inner source of inspiration

For myself it should have been a no-brainer. I do what I do for the sheer enjoyment. Nothing for me has ever equaled the satisfaction of writing. Doing what you enjoy plus the satisfaction of doing it equals inspiration. This applies in whether you want to achieve and accomplish in life. The principles of the formula are applicable to every single thing you want in life. If you take away one or the other you change the equation and wind up with a different answer every time. Many times the new answer will be the answer you don't want. A negative will cancel out inspiration every time.

How to work your magic

Norman Vincent Peale, the author of “The Power of Positive Thinking, said, “Change your thoughts and change your world.” He also said, “We tend to get we expect.” Now, you may be thinking this didn't work for me. Why, because I sat there expecting waiting for the positive of inspiration to come to me. The source of my problem was I combined that with the negative thoughts of “I can't find the inspiration.” Mathematically, when you combine a negative with a positive you wind up with less than what you had to start with. Eliminate the negative from your thoughts and you work from the positive all the time. In short do not acknowledge what you don't have if you want to the full benefit of what you want. Think this is what I need and want. Don't allow yourself to get discouraged because it did not just come about.

How this first worked for me.

I wanted to write, be published and make more money. I became be simply doing all things that pertained to writing. What is writing? It is thoughts plus words on paper equal writing. So, in a year over 260 articles and two books later, I grew closer to my goal. I was published but they haven't sent the Pulitzer yet. The key is I am no longer waiting around for it come. I am taking the actions which each day bring this event closer to being a reality. Now, when I sit down to write I look at this two foot high pile. It consists of my rough drafts and other writing attempts that over time resulted in that goal of creating more money for me. They as any thing we create and accomplish in life are a part of me. They serve as my inspiration. When you change your thoughts, you change your perspective, and you unlock the inspiration that will empower your life.
